Software Engineering AFAC Client Check-in and Referral System The Arlington Food Assistance Center (AFAC) is a community-based non-profit organization that provides supplemental groceries to Arlington County, Virginia residents in need. Now over 20 years after its founding, AFAC remains dedicated to its simple but critical mission of obtaining and distributing groceries, directly and free of charge, to people who cannot afford to purchase enough food to meet their basic needs. AFAC clients are families that have received referrals from Arlington government agencies, churches, schools, and/or social service agencies. SJI Support The State Justice Institute (SJI) was established by federal law in 1984 to award grants to improve the quality of justice in state courts, facilitate better coordination between state and federal courts, and foster innovative solutions to common issues faced by all courts. SJI’s mission is unique in that it has the sole authority to assist all state courts, (Criminal, civil, juvenile, family, and appellate) and it carries the mandate to share the successes of each entity’s innovations throughout the justice system. Gates Millennium Scholars Program The UNCF Gates Millennium Scholarship Program was established in 1999 via a grant from the Bill and Melinda Gates foundation, to promote academic excellence and provide an opportunity for outstanding minority students to reach their highest potential. The GMS program is more than just a scholarship, it offers ACademic Empowerment (ACE) services to encourage academic excellence; mentoring services for academic and personal development; and an online resource center that provides internship, fellowship and scholarship information. USMC Total Force Retention System (TFRS) The Total Force Retention System (TFRS) is the information support system that enables the Marine Corps Career Retention Force to systematically input, review, and dispose of personnel information needed to process a Reenlistment, Extension or Lateral Move Request, and to extend current enlistments (RELMs). The application supports both active duty and reserve forces, and the principal users consist of Career Retention Specialists (CRSs) and Headquarters Marine Corps (HQMC) staff. USAF SAF/AQXR Application Development and Support The Acquisition Integration Directorate under the Secretary of the Air Force (SAF/AQX) is responsible for the planning, management and analysis of the Air Force research and development, and acquisition investment budget. Each year, SAF/AQX gathers information from sources around the globe, then prepares and submits budget justification documents – detailed descriptions of nearly $40 billion in Air Force resources – to the Office of the Secretary of Defense (OSD) and Congress.
